Description:
John Stokell Mahogany Astronomical Floor Regulator, New York, c. 1840, flat-top molded hood with lamb's ear decorated canted columns flanking the 13-in. dia. silvered dial marked "Stokell/New York," arabic numeral outer minute track, running seconds and roman numeral hour dial, similarly decorated trunk with full-length glass waist door, two-panel base with beaded center, all on a simple stepped base, eight-day movement with 4 mm thick trapezoidal plates, maintaining power, and deadbeat escapement, jeweled pallets, brass-cased weight, and a single-jar mercury temperature compensating pendulum, ht. 79 in.
